The Aygo was launched back in 2005, as a sub-Yaris city car, and has carved a justifiably successful niche for itself across Europe, selling more than 100,000 in the process. As with all Toyotas it’s well built, and is actually a pretty nimble car with fun driving dynamics. Toyota Aygo updated for 2009 with new additions - The Toyota Aygo Black and The Toyota Aygo Blue The 2009 Aygo gets a few tweaks to improve fuel economy and emissions (now 106g/km) and a few body tweaks, including a re-sculpted nose.

Volkswagen Beetle

Mon, 18 Apr 2011

The 2012 Beetle has been unveiled ahead of its Shanghai Motor Show reveal. The new 'New Beetle' is said to draw on design cues from the original Beetle launched 73 years ago. Retaining a similar silhouette to the 2003 New Beetle, the 2012 model gains a stronger influence from the 2005 Detroit show 'Ragster' concept.
